Quinlan, TX's wildfire risk, in USFS's own numbers
USFS's Wildfire Risk to Communities model puts Quinlan at the 72nd national percentile for risk to structures, well above the national norm for wildfire risk — a score built from 826 actual buildings. (Source: USFS's Wildfire Risk to Communities methodology.)
Separately from the risk score above, Quinlan's burn probability — fire likelihood with no building count factored in — sits at the 72nd percentile nationally.
What "at risk" means for the buildings here
Indirect exposure is dominant in Quinlan (58.8% of 826 buildings): far enough from burnable vegetation to avoid flame contact, close enough for wind-blown embers. Only 41.2% sit in the Direct zone.
Where Quinlan ranks
Inside Texas, Quinlan sits at just the 36th percentile even though it scores 72nd nationally — the state's overall wildfire exposure is high enough to make this a relatively quiet corner of it. Among the 31,521 US communities USFS scores, Quinlan ranks 8,873 for wildfire risk (1 is highest) and 13,391 by building count (1 is largest). Within Texas alone, it ranks 1,148 of 1,795 places by risk. See the full county-by-county picture for Texas on its state page.

Lowering exposure, not just insuring around it
Quinlan's 58.8% Indirect-exposure share points at embers, not flame contact, as the main pathway — ember-resistant vents and non-combustible roofing rank ahead of defensible space here. Detail in the home-hardening guide.
